#6c321a - RGB(108, 50, 26) - Metallic Copper Color FAQ

What is the color code for Metallic Copper?

Hex color code for Metallic Copper color is #6c321a. RGB color code for metallic copper color is rgb(108, 50, 26).

What is the RGB value of #6c321a?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#6c321a is rgb(108, 50, 26).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'108' indicates the intensity of the red component, '50' represents the green component's intensity, and '26'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#6c321a.

What is the RGB percentage of #6c321a?

The RGB percentage composition for the hexadecimal color code #6c321a is detailed as follows: 42.4% Red, 19.6% Green, and 10.2% Blue. This breakdown indicates the relative contribution of each primary color in the RGB color model to achieve this specific shade. The value 42.4% for Red signifies a dominant red component, contributing significantly to the overall color. The Green and Blue components are comparatively lower, with 19.6% and 10.2% respectively, playing a smaller role in the composition of this particular hue. Together, these percentages of Red, Green, and Blue mix to form the distinct color represented by #6c321a.

What does RGB 108,50,26 mean?

The RGB color 108, 50, 26 represents a dull and muted shade of Red. The websafe version of this color is hex 663333.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Metallic Copper.
